This issue tracker has been migrated to GitHub, and is currently read-only.
For more information, see the GitHub FAQs in the Python's Developer Guide.

Author pitrou
Recipients pitrou, scoder, serhiy.storchaka
Date 2017-12-20.15:29:11
SpamBayes Score -1.0
Marked as misclassified Yes
Message-id <1513783751.77.0.213398074469.issue32346@psf.upfronthosting.co.za>
In-reply-to
Content
Updated benchmarks against git master (and using pyperf):

- before:

$ ./env-orig/bin/pyperf timeit -q "class Test: pass"
Mean +- std dev: 8.89 us +- 0.09 us
$ ./env-orig/bin/pyperf timeit -q -s "from logging import Logger" "class Test(Logger): pass"
Mean +- std dev: 12.0 us +- 0.2 us
$ ./env-orig/bin/pyperf timeit -q -s "from unittest.mock import MagicMock" "class Test(MagicMock): pass"
Mean +- std dev: 18.6 us +- 0.2 us

- after:

$ ./env/bin/pyperf timeit -q "class Test: pass"
Mean +- std dev: 6.90 us +- 0.11 us
$ ./env/bin/pyperf timeit -q -s "from logging import Logger" "class Test(Logger): pass"
Mean +- std dev: 5.86 us +- 0.08 us
$ ./env/bin/pyperf timeit -q -s "from unittest.mock import MagicMock" "class Test(MagicMock): pass"
Mean +- std dev: 6.13 us +- 0.08 us
History
Date User Action Args
2017-12-20 15:29:11pitrousetrecipients: + pitrou, scoder, serhiy.storchaka
2017-12-20 15:29:11pitrousetmessageid: <1513783751.77.0.213398074469.issue32346@psf.upfronthosting.co.za>
2017-12-20 15:29:11pitroulinkissue32346 messages
2017-12-20 15:29:11pitroucreate